Splet14. jul. 2024 · Payback percentages and return to player (RTP) are the same thing, and they refer to how much money a slot machine pays over the long term. Here’s an example. A slot machine has 94% RTP You bet $100 on this game 100 x 0.94 = $94 This slot machine will theoretically pay you $94 for every $100 wagered Splet14. jun. 2024 · The payback percentage is the average amount the machine returns for every dollar wagered. This percentage is based on hundreds of thousands of hands and also includes the elusive royal flush. This means that in the short term, which can consist of thousands of hands, your return may be higher or lower than the numbers listed below.
